Linux系统下轻松安装VMware指南
在linux下安装vmware

首页 2025-02-19 19:38:38



在Linux下安装VMware:解锁虚拟化技术的无限可能 在当今多元化的计算环境中,虚拟化技术以其独特的优势——资源优化、灵活部署、高效管理等,成为了IT领域不可或缺的一部分

    VMware,作为虚拟化技术的领军者,不仅在企业级数据中心大放异彩,也在个人开发者、教育工作者及科研人员中享有盛誉

    尽管VMware最初以Windows平台为主要阵地,但随着Linux操作系统的日益普及和强大,在Linux环境下安装并使用VMware也成为了众多技术爱好者的首选

    本文将详细阐述如何在Linux系统下安装VMware Workstation或VMware Player,以及这一过程中可能遇到的挑战与解决方案,旨在帮助读者轻松解锁虚拟化技术的无限潜能

     一、准备工作:系统要求与环境配置 在动手之前,确保你的Linux系统满足VMware的最低硬件和软件要求至关重要

    以下是安装VMware Workstation或Player前的基本检查清单: 1.操作系统版本:VMware支持多种Linux发行版,包括但不限于Ubuntu、CentOS、Fedora、Debian等

    确保你的系统版本在官方支持列表中

     2.CPU要求:至少需要一个支持虚拟化技术(如Intel VT-x或AMD-V)的处理器

     3.内存:至少2GB RAM,建议4GB或以上以获得更佳性能

     4.磁盘空间:至少需要2GB的可用磁盘空间用于安装VMware软件,每个虚拟机还需额外空间

     5.图形环境:虽然VMware Workstation提供了命令行界面安装选项,但图形用户界面(GUI)能极大简化配置过程

     6.用户权限:确保你有足够的权限安装软件,通常需要root权限或使用`sudo`命令

     二、下载VMware安装包 访问VMware官方网站,根据你的Linux发行版选择相应的VMware Workstation或VMware Player下载链接

    注意区分32位和64位版本,确保下载与你的系统架构相匹配的安装包

    下载完成后,可以使用命令行或文件管理器解压安装包

     三、安装VMware 1.打开终端:在Linux桌面环境中,打开终端应用程序

     2.导航到安装包目录:使用cd命令进入存放VMware安装包的目录

     3.赋予执行权限(如适用):某些下载的安装包可能是压缩包形式,解压后得到的可能是二进制执行文件

    使用`chmod +x filename.bin`命令为文件添加执行权限

     4.运行安装程序:通过./filename.bin命令启动安装程序

    如果是.rpm或.deb格式,可以直接使用包管理器安装,如`sudo dpkg -i filename.deb`(Debian/Ubuntu)或`sudo rpm -ivh filename.rpm`(CentOS/Fedora)

     5.遵循图形界面提示:安装向导将引导你完成安装过程,包括接受许可协议、选择安装位置、是否创建桌面图标等

     6.完成安装:安装完成后,根据提示重启系统或重新登录以应用所有更改

     四、配置与首次使用 1.启动VMware:在应用程序菜单中找到VMware图标并启动,或通过终端输入`vmware`命令启动

     2.注册与许可:如果是VMware Workstation,首次启动时可能需要输入许可证密钥以解锁全部功能

    VMware Player则提供免费使用,无需注册

     3.创建虚拟机:点击“创建新的虚拟机”按钮,按照向导提示选择操作系统类型、版本、分配内存、创建或指定虚拟硬盘等

     4.安装操作系统:配置完成后,启动虚拟机,通过ISO镜像文件或物理光盘安装所需的操作系统

     5.安装VMware Tools:为了提高虚拟机性能,特别是实现全屏显示、共享文件夹等功能,建议在虚拟机中安装VMware Tools

     五、常见问题与解决方案 1.图形界面显示问题:如遇到虚拟机显示异常,检查是否已正确安装并启用VMware Tools,以及宿主机的显卡驱动是否最新

     2.性能瓶颈:虚拟机运行缓慢可能是由于资源分配不足

    尝试增加分配给虚拟机的CPU核心数和内存大小,同时确保宿主机未运行过多占用资源的程序

     3.网络配置:虚拟机网络连接问题可通过检查VMware的网络适配器设置解决

    NAT模式适用于访问外部网络,桥接模式则允许虚拟机与宿主机在同一网络中

     4.兼容性问题:某些操作系统或软件可能与特定版本的VMware不完全兼容

    查阅VMware官方文档或社区论坛获取兼容性信息和解决方案

     六、总结与展望 在Linux下安装VMware不仅为技术探索者提供了一个强大的虚拟化平台,也为学习、开发、测试等多种场景提供了灵活高效的解决方案

    通过本文的指导,你应当能够顺利地在Linux系统上安装并配置VMware,开启你的虚拟化之旅

    随着技术的不断进步,VMware及其生态系统将持续进化,为用户提供更加丰富、智能、安全的虚拟化体验

    无论是追求极致性能的企业级应用,还是满足个性化需求的个人项目,VMware都是值得信赖的伙伴

    让我们携手并进,在虚拟化的广阔天地中探索无限可能

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道